# Break-Glass: Catalog Cache Invalidation

Scope: the Pinrow product catalog at Veldstone Retail. If stale prices persist after a purge and the Hollowmere invalidation queue is wedged, use break-glass to flush the edge tier directly. Contractors: get verbal sign-off from the catalog lead first. Steps: open the Hollowmere admin shell, select emergency-flush, confirm the tenant, and run it once — repeated flushes thrash the origin. Access is logged and expires after 20 minutes. Unseal the admin shell with the passphrase below.

recovery phrase for kahop-tajog: istix-casvan

TURN-208: Gatevale turnstile counters at the Merrow Field pilot double-count when a rotation reverses mid-cycle. Attendance totals drift roughly 2% high per event. The debounce window fix is implemented, reviewed by Ilsa, and soak-tested across two simulated match days without drift. Ready for your cut; the candidate build is identified below.

trace token, tagag-tafog: htk6_5ed18c

### Step 4 — DNS workaround

The Gravelpond resolver intermittently fails during deploys; symptoms: registry pulls time out, then succeed. Pin the internal registry IP in the deploy host's resolv override before starting. Do not skip this — half-completed deploys leave the Ortolan fleet in mixed versions. After pinning, flush the resolver cache, rerun the preflight check, and confirm all nodes resolve the artifact host identically. Then sign the rollout manifest using the deploy key provided below.

deploy key for kajof-fajop: bky6_gDHw9Q